WebDynamic Programming: Weighted Interval Scheduling Weighted interval scheduling is another classic DP problem. It is the more general version of the activity selection problem. Objective: The maximum subarray problem is the task of finding the contiguous subarray within a one-dimensional array of numbers that has the largest sum.
